You need to understand what your clients are searching for (how much does a real estate agent cost). Narrow it down to what kind of propertyare they looking for a single household or condo? Are they house-hacking a duplex, or purchasing an investment property? For retail clients, you need to set reasonable expectations. A client looking for a four-bedroom penthouse apartment or condo overlooking Central Park with a budget plan of $150,000 isn't going to find excessive.
What is the minimum variety of bathrooms they can tolerate? What about bedrooms, square video footage, backyard size, garage area? Next I inquire about their maxthe optimum quantity they desire to spend, and their optimum regular monthly payment. Then I plug those basic specifications into the numerous listing service (MLS) and see what appears.

A CMA, or a comparative market analysis, is when you evaluate the market instantly surrounding your subject property. For the most part, houses evaluate for what other, similar homes in the area sold for recently. No two houses are the very same, so no two appraisals will return the exact same.
